Khan Baba Kandi (Persian: خان باباكندي)[a] is a village in Qeshlaq-e Sharqi Rural District[4] of Qeshlaq Dasht District in Bileh Savar County, Ardabil province, Iran.

Demographics

Population

At the time of the 2006 National Census, the village's population was 905 in 181 households.[5] The following census in 2011 counted 862 people in 225 households.[6] The 2016 census measured the population of the village as 871 people in 260 households.[2]
